this Quest was origionaly designed by reverian
Fixed a minor bug of a few )'s missing --- zip is updated
All i have done is made it 2.0 compliant
and to compact the code down
and to make it very easy to add in for custom ingots to be used
to adjust for your custom ingots just find this spot in the code of the ingotless blacksmith.cs:
Code:
else if( i_resource >= 2 && i_resource <= 9 )
and change the 9 to equal the highest number of the ingot type you want to use
9 = valorite (if you have not placed any lower than val in - if you have (like silver) then change to 10, etc - easy way is to look at oreinfo.cs - find close to the top the listing of the ores - dull is 2 then count down from there to the one you want to stop at and use that number)
also in the gump one need to change this line to state the name of the highest ore you want used:
Code:
"<BASEFONT COLOR=White>They have to be at least Dull Copper and no better than Valorite<br><br>" +
to adjust the amount they have to turn in to get the hammer is in 2 spots - 1 in each file:
Code:
"<BASEFONT COLOR=White>If you can bring me 10000 colored ingots, I will give you a great reward.<br><br>" +
Code:
if( dropped.Amount != 10000)
just change the 10000 to the amount you would like it to be
the bonus reward of powerscrolls can be easily adjusted also it you wish
(just mod the numbers around or even replace with a totaly different reward - i have done that on mine, but i did the powerscrolls here so no other files are needed)
